ABSTRACT:
A magnetic recording medium is disclosed, comprising a non-magnetic support having thereon plural magnetic layers containing ferromagnetic particles dispersed in a binder including at least one inner magnetic layer and an outer magnetic layer, wherein said ferromagnetic particles present in said outer magnetic layer are Co-FeOx (1.33.ltoreq.x.ltoreq.1.5) having a coercive force of from 800 to 1000 Oe, an average length in the long axis of less than 0.30 .mu.m as measured transmission by electronmicroscope, and a crystallite size of less than 300 .ANG. as measured by X-ray diffraction, and, the crystallite size and the thickness of the inner magnetic layer are larger than those of said outer magnetic layer.
